Subject: [PATCH 3/6] hwrng: omap3-rom - Call clk_prepare() on init and exit only
Date: Fri, 13 Sep 2019 15:09:19 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20190913220922.29501-4-tony@atomide.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20190913220922.29501-1-tony@atomide.com>
When unloading omap3-rom-rng, we'll get the following:
WARNING: CPU: 0 PID: 100 at drivers/clk/clk.c:948 clk_core_disable
This is because the clock is already disabled by omap3_rom_rng_idle().
Also, we should not call prepare and unprepare except during init, and
only call enable and disable during use.

drivers/char/hw_random/omap3-rom-rng.c | 24 ++++++++++++++++++------
1 file changed, 18 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/char/hw_random/omap3-rom-rng.c b/drivers/char/hw_random/omap3-rom-rng.c
--- a/drivers/char/hw_random/omap3-rom-rng.c
+++ b/drivers/char/hw_random/omap3-rom-rng.c
@@ -44,7 +44,7 @@ static void omap3_rom_rng_idle(struct work_struct *work)
pr_err("reset failed: %d\n", r);
return;
}
- clk_disable_unprepare(rng_clk);
+ clk_disable(rng_clk);
rng_idle = 1;
}
@@ -55,13 +55,13 @@ static int omap3_rom_rng_get_random(void *buf, unsigned int count)
cancel_delayed_work_sync(&idle_work);
if (rng_idle) {
- r = clk_prepare_enable(rng_clk);
+ r = clk_enable(rng_clk);
if (r)
return r;
r = omap3_rom_rng_call(0, 0, RNG_GEN_PRNG_HW_INIT);
if (r != 0) {
- clk_disable_unprepare(rng_clk);
+ clk_disable(rng_clk);
pr_err("HW init failed: %d\n", r);
return -EIO;
}
@@ -114,20 +114,32 @@ static int omap3_rom_rng_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
return PTR_ERR(rng_clk);
}
+ ret = clk_prepare(rng_clk);
+ if (ret < 0) {
+ dev_err(&pdev->dev, "clk_prepare failed: %i\n", ret);
+ return ret;
+ }
+
/* Leave the RNG in reset state. */
- ret = clk_prepare_enable(rng_clk);
+ ret = clk_enable(rng_clk);
if (ret)
- return ret;
+ goto err_unprepare;
omap3_rom_rng_idle(0);
return hwrng_register(&omap3_rom_rng_ops);
+
+err_unprepare:
+ clk_unprepare(rng_clk);
+
+ return ret;
}
static int omap3_rom_rng_remove(struct platform_device *pdev)
{
cancel_delayed_work_sync(&idle_work);
hwrng_unregister(&omap3_rom_rng_ops);
- clk_disable_unprepare(rng_clk);
+ clk_unprepare(rng_clk);
+
return 0;
}
